site stats

C++ function for gcd

WebJun 13, 2024 · Time Complexity: time required for finding gcd of all the elements in the vector will be overall time complexity. vector at a time can have maximum number of unique elements from the array. so . time needed to find gcd of two elements log(max(two numbers)) so time required to find gcd of all unique elements will be O(unique elements … WebReturn value. If both m and n are zero, returns zero. Otherwise, returns the greatest common divisor of m and n . [] RemarksIf either M or N is not an integer type, or if …

Greatest common divisor - Wikipedia

WebJun 10, 2024 · Euclids algorithm to find gcd has been discussed here. C++ has the built-in function for calculating GCD. This function is present in header file. Syntax for C++14 : … WebJan 3, 2024 · I am able to call this function on an Ubuntu 16.04 install as well as Windows Subsystem for Linux, but not Windows. Note as well, there's a std::gcd() function … rainbow high girls drawings https://thecircuit-collective.com

Greatest Common Divisor (GCD) Find GCD with Examples

WebJan 16, 2024 · GCD (Greatest Common Divisor) or HCF (Highest Common Factor) of two numbers is the largest number that divides both of them. For example GCD of 20 and 28 … WebMar 14, 2024 · Program to Find GCD or HCF of Two Numbers. It is a process of repeat subtraction, carrying the result forward each time until the result is equal to any one number being subtracted. If the ... likewise when a=36 & b=60 ,here b>a so b = 24 & a= … WebOutput. Enter two positive integers: 81 153 GCD = 9. This is a better way to find the GCD. In this method, smaller integer is subtracted from the larger integer, and the result is assigned to the variable holding larger integer. This process is continued until n1 and n2 are equal. The above two programs works as intended only if the user enters ... rainbow high girls pajamas

C++ Program To Find GCD or HCF of Two Numbers

Category:C++ : Find the Greatest Common Divisor (GCD) of two numbers …

Tags:C++ function for gcd

C++ function for gcd

The Euclidean Algorithm (article) Khan Academy

WebSep 1, 2024 · The Euclidean algorithm is a way to find the greatest common divisor of two positive integers. GCD of two numbers is the largest number that divides both of them. ... Below is a recursive function to … WebJan 16, 2024 · A simple solution is to find all prime factors of both numbers, then find union of all factors present in both numbers. Finally, return the product of elements in union. An efficient solution is based on the below formula for LCM of two numbers ‘a’ and ‘b’. a x b = LCM (a, b) * GCD (a, b) LCM (a, b) = (a x b) / GCD (a, b)

C++ function for gcd

Did you know?

WebDefinition and Usage. The math.gcd () method returns the greatest common divisor of the two integers int1 and int2. GCD is the largest common divisor that divides the numbers without a remainder. GCD is also known as the highest common factor … WebMar 14,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ebGCD function in c++ sans cmath library. Related. 46 "Approximate" greatest common divisor. 1. Understanding Viterbi Algorithm. 161. Conveniently Declaring Compile-Time Strings in C++. 1. Dividing a number into groups of numbers. 0. Struggling to understand how this code outputs Euclid algorithm. 3. WebIn mathematics, the greatest common divisor (GCD) of two or more integers, which are not all zero, is the largest positive integer that divides each of the integers. For two integers x, y, the greatest common divisor of x and y is denoted (,).For example, the GCD of 8 and 12 is 4, that is, (,) =. In the name "greatest common divisor", the adjective "greatest" …

WebAlgorithm to find GCD of two numbers using recursion. Take input of two numbers in x and y. call the function GCD by passing x and y. Inside the GCD function call the GDC function by passing y and x%y (i.e. GCD (y, x%y) with the base case y = 0. means, if y is eqal to zero then return x.

WebJun 24, 2024 · C++ Programming Server Side Programming. The Greatest Common Divisor (GCD) of two numbers is the largest number that divides both of them. For example: Let’s say we have following two numbers: 45 and 27. 63 = 7 * 3 * 3 42 = 7 * 3 * 2 So, the GCD of 63 and 42 is 21. A program to find the GCD of two numbers using recursion is …

WebJul 30, 2024 · C++ Program to Find the GCD and LCM of n Numbers. This is the code to find out the GCD and LCM of n numbers. The GCD or Greatest Common Divisor of two or more integers, which are not all zero, is the largest positive integer that divides each of the integers. GCD is also known as Greatest Common Factor. The least common … rainbow high girls picturesWebOct 25, 2024 · As a side note, the C++ standard library has a std::gcd function that can calculate the gcd of two numbers and I will also show you how to use the STL version. … rainbow high glitchWebJun 24, 2024 · C++ Program to Find GCD. C++ Programming Server Side Programming. The Greatest Common Divisor (GCD) of two numbers is the largest number that divides … rainbow high girls jewelry